Diagnostic hysteroscopy
It is a medical procedure that examines the interior of the uterus and the cervical canal. It is performed with a thin, flexible instrument called a hysteroscope, which has a camera at the tip. It is used to analyze abnormal uterine bleeding, fertility problems, uterine abnormalities, remove a translocated IUD, etc.


HPV Detection and Treatment
Human papillomavirus (HPV) is a very common sexually transmitted infection. Most of the time, the body clears it on its own, but some types of the virus can cause health problems such as genital warts and, in cases of persistent infection, can lead to the development of cancer, especially cervical cancer.

Vaginal rejuvenation
It refers to a series of aesthetic and functional procedures that seek to improve the appearance, tone, sensitivity, and overall health of the female genital area. These treatments may be an option for people experiencing changes in their intimate area due to factors such as childbirth, aging, weight fluctuations, or menopause.


Taking biopsies
It is a medical procedure in which a small sample of tissue or cells is removed from the body for examination in a laboratory. It is a crucial diagnostic tool that offers maximum certainty in determining whether tissue is benign (noncancerous) or malignant (cancerous), as well as in identifying other diseases.
